我们拥有一支由40多名工程师组成的团队,致力于共同的代码库。我们正在使用resharper,并通过电子邮件发送人们可以导入的“确定”配置文件来共享我们建议的设置。
然而,随着时间的推移,我们希望收紧新版本和新作品上的各种内容,而不需要对旧版本进行重构。
我们认为在Resharper设置的文件中使用每个解决方案共享的设置选项可以很好地工作。
我们可以将.resharper文件添加到我们的解决方案文件夹中,并在SVN中将它们标记为只能由我们的编码标准机构编写。
但是,除非您打开该选项,否则其中一个文件的纯粹没有Resharper实例使用它,在这种情况下,文件将被当前设置覆盖。如果您关闭选项,Resharper会删除该文件。
无论如何我们可以触发Resharper切换到正确的模式并使用该文件而不试图破坏它吗?
同样,是否有一种好方法可以触发Resharper + StyleCop使用我们希望提供的相应项目特定的StyelCop设置文件?
由于
答案 0 :(得分:3)
Re:StyleCop,项目中有一个Settings.StyleCop文件应该足以让StyleCop(和StyleCop For ReSharper)使用这些设置而不是全局设置。